Alexey Koptsevich wrote:

> >camcontrol defects da2 -f bfi -G
> Got 5 defects:
> 914:5:218112
> 2118:2:20480
> 2118:2:20992
> 2119:2:20480
> 2119:2:25088
>
> Are there any standards for the number of bad blocks allowed for the disk
> during warranty period? Other interesting thing is that

I think its even a small number for glist.

> >camcontrol defects da2 -f bfi -G |wc
> Got 5 defects:
>        5       5      65
> >camcontrol defects da2 -f bfi -P |wc
> Got 6156 defects:
>     6156    6156   85238
>
> Can such large number of primary defects be considered as normal? Which
> defect growth rate may one expect from such figure from this
> (modern) drive (it is of course informal question)?

Yep, its quite normal.

Here I'm coming again with my old proposal:
There should be a periodic script which compares glist from today and glist
from, say week ago and from install time and put it in [daily/weekly/monthly]
mail.
